Triangles are Good!

This is a big day for me. Today was the first day in about 4 weeks that I was able to wear my regular clothes AND take the subway all by myself to a doctor’s appointment. Writing these words makes me feel like I am a 5 year old; however, for me these are some delightful accomplishments. Think about it…NYC Subway (the crowds, the stairs, the crowds, the humid air, and the crowds) all on my own. If you can survive the subway you can really survive anything! There was a song about surviving in NYC (not the subway, but NYC.) If you can make it here you can make it anywhere. I believe that is the line, but then I am getting off topic.

The incision on my stomach is about 12 inches long. It is healing better than I expected. The part that I did not expect is all the wavy parts on my stomach. No one ever tells you this stuff. I was so focused on the incision that would be left as a reminder that I never imagined the shape of my stomach would change. Rather than being a half dome like most people’s, MY stomach is more of a triangle. They just don’t make clothes for triangular stomachs. Since the incision is still healing, it is very sensitive to touch and presents a challenge when I attempt to wear regular clothes instead of my workout clothes. My doctors are trying to reassure me that both of these things will change over time. The question is in how much time?
